Model Analytics & Market Report
We've analyzed more than 59,100 sales records of this model and here are some numbers.
The average price for new (MSRP) 2017 CHEVROLET BOLT EV in 2017 was $38,705.
The average price for used 2017 CHEVROLET BOLT EV nowadays in 2024 is $14,950 which is 39% from the original price.
Estimated mileage driven per year is 6,642 miles.

The 'country of origin' in a VIN, indicated by the first one to three characters, tells you where the vehicle was built, which could influence parts availability and design standards.

Most VIN decoders do not provide color information as this is not typically encoded in the VIN; color information is usually obtained from vehicle registration documents or manufacturer records.
A VIN alone does not typically provide fuel economy details directly; however, it can identify the vehicle model and engine type, which you can cross-reference with fuel economy data from other sources.
